TFFRCNN:深度学习目标检测框架在GitHub上的应用

什么是TFFRCNN?

TFFRCNN是一个基于TensorFlow框架的深度学习目标检测模型,结合了Faster R-CNN和特定的优化算法。这个模型专注于提升目标检测的精度和速度,广泛应用于各种计算机视觉任务中。TFFRCNN的核心思想是利用卷积神经网络(CNN)提取特征,并通过回归和分类器进行目标检测。

TFFRCNN的主要特征

  • 高效性:通过特定的优化策略,提高模型的训练和推理速度。
  • 可扩展性:支持多种预训练模型的使用,用户可以根据需要进行调整。
  • 开源:项目托管在GitHub上,易于访问和修改。

在GitHub上找到TFFRCNN

要找到TFFRCNN的GitHub页面,可以使用以下步骤:

  1. 打开 GitHub官网
  2. 在搜索框中输入“TFFRCNN”。
  3. 浏览搜索结果,找到对应的项目链接。

TFFRCNN GitHub链接

TFFRCNN的安装指南

要在本地安装和运行TFFRCNN,您需要按照以下步骤进行操作:

  1. 克隆项目:在终端中输入命令 git clone https://github.com/username/TFFRCNN.git
  2. 安装依赖:进入项目文件夹,使用 pip install -r requirements.txt 命令安装所需依赖。
  3. 下载预训练模型:根据项目文档中的说明,下载适用的预训练模型。

TFFRCNN的使用方法

数据准备

在使用TFFRCNN进行目标检测之前,需要准备合适的数据集。一般来说,您可以选择常用的数据集,例如:

  • COCO数据集
  • Pascal VOC
  • 自定义数据集

模型训练

训练模型时,用户需要使用特定的训练脚本。以下是训练的基本步骤:

  1. 配置文件设置:根据数据集和需求修改配置文件。
  2. 启动训练:在终端中运行 python train.py --config config.yml
  3. 监控训练进度:使用TensorBoard监控训练过程。

模型评估

在训练完成后,使用评估脚本对模型进行性能评估:

bash python evaluate.py –model path/to/model –data path/to/dataset

TFFRCNN的应用场景

TFFRCNN适用于多个应用场景,包括但不限于:

  • 自动驾驶:实时检测道路上的物体。
  • 视频监控:分析监控视频中的目标活动。
  • 医疗影像:在医学影像中检测特定的病灶或特征。

常见问题解答(FAQ)

TFFRCNN是什么?

TFFRCNN是一个深度学习目标检测框架,基于TensorFlow构建,结合了Faster R-CNN的技术,旨在提高目标检测的效率和准确性。

如何在GitHub上使用TFFRCNN?

您可以访问TFFRCNN的GitHub页面,下载项目代码,安装依赖,并按照项目文档进行模型训练和评估。

TFFRCNN支持哪些数据集?

TFFRCNN支持多种数据集,如COCO、Pascal VOC等,同时也可以使用用户自定义的数据集。

如何优化TFFRCNN的性能?

优化TFFRCNN的性能可以通过调整模型参数、使用不同的预训练模型和数据增强技术来实现。

TFFRCNN适用于哪些领域?

TFFRCNN可广泛应用于自动驾驶、视频监控、医疗影像等多个领域的目标检测任务。

正文完